Займ онлайн на любую сумму без справки о доходах!
 Главная / Разное / Вы сейчас просматриваете:

Энергия в сети TRON: как она работает, зачем нужна и как с ней обращаться

SQLITE NOT INSTALLED

Тот, кто впервые сталкивается с TRON, может почувствовать себя в новом городе без карты: все блоки есть, транзакции летают, но зачем нужна «энергия» — непонятно. На самом деле энергия — это не абстрактная валюта, а конкретный ресурс сети, который оплачивает выполнение смарт‑контрактов. Понимание механики помогает экономить средства и делать приложения удобнее для пользователей. В этой статье я без лишних терминов и воды объясню, что такое энергия в TRON, как её получить, когда выгодно платить TRX и как оптимизировать расходы.

Я не буду засыпать вас техническими терминами ради их звучания. Лучше — практические сценарии и советы, которые реально пригодятся при разработке децентрализованных приложений или при отправке транзакций. Если вы уже разработчик, найдете идеи для оптимизации. Если вы пользователь — поймёте, почему иногда выгодно «заморозить» TRX, а иногда — просто заплатить за выполнение операции.

Содержание

Что такое энергия и чем она отличается от полосы пропускания

В TRON есть два основных ресурса: полоса пропускания, чаще называемая bandwidth, и энергия. Полоса пропускания нужна для обычных транзакций — переводы токенов, простые операции. Энергия требуется тогда, когда транзакция вызывает смарт‑контракт и изменяет состояние блокчейна. Это логично: выполнение кода требует ресурсов, а приватный перевод — почти ничего. На сайте FeeSaver можно получить больше информации про энергию в сети TRON.

Главная мысль: если ваша операция не меняет данные в контракте, скорее всего она не потребует энергии. Но если контракт пишет в хранилище, запускает вычисления или взаимодействует с другими контрактами, энергия будет расходоваться. Это влияет и на стоимость транзакции, и на UX — когда у пользователя недостаточно ресурсов, операция может не пройти.

Почему сеть ввела такой подход

Разделение на ресурсы решает несколько задач одновременно. Оно позволяет снизить стоимость базовых переводов для массового использования и одновременно предотвратить бесконтрольную нагрузку на вычислительную часть. Представьте, что смарт‑контракты — это дорогие вычисления; логично платить дополнительно за их выполнение. Кроме того, модель стимулирует аккуратность в коде и экономию хранения данных.

Для разработчиков это ещё и инструмент: можно спонсировать транзакции пользователей, замораживая TRX и раздавая ресурсы, вместо того чтобы заставлять каждого платящего платить за каждую операцию отдельно. Это улучшает первый опыт пользователя и снижает барьер входа.

Как получить энергию: заморозка или покупка

Энергию можно получить двумя путями. Первый — заморозить TRX в своём кошельке. Взамен сеть начисляет ресурсы, среди которых будет энергия. Второй — если у вас энергии недостаточно, можно купить её за TRX через механизм покупки ресурсов в сети. Это похоже на аренду: вы платите сразу за то, что потребуется в ближайшее время.

Преимущество заморозки в том, что это экономичнее для постоянных пользователей или сервисов с высокой активностью. Минус — это связывание средств на некоторое время. Покупка энергии удобна для разовых операций или когда нужно срочно выполнить тяжёлую транзакцию и нет возможности или желания замораживать средства.

Читайте также:  Какой диаметр трубы лучше использовать для водопровода в квартире

Пара практических замечаний

Когда вы замораживаете TRX, вы также получаете и другие плюшки, например право голоса в сети — это важный момент для тех, кто участвует в управлении. Если у вас DApp с большим количеством пользователей, выгоднее распределять ресурсы централизованно, то есть замораживать TRX на адресе приложения и делегировать энергию либо оплачивать операции за пользователей.

Покупка энергии привязана к текущей цене сети и может меняться в зависимости от нагрузки. Поэтому для долгосрочных планов лучше рассчитывать экономику проекта исходя из заморозки, а для единичных задач использовать покупку.

Энергия в сети TRON: как она работает, зачем нужна и как с ней обращаться

Таблица: сравнение энергии и полосы пропускания

Параметр Энергия Полоса пропускания (bandwidth)
Когда расходуется При выполнении смарт‑контрактов, записи в состояние При отправке транзакций, которые не запускают контракты
Как получить Заморозить TRX или купить энергию за TRX Заморозить TRX (даёт ежедневные свободные байты) или использовать платную модель
Чем измеряется В единицах потребления вычислений (gas‑аналог) В байтах, рассчитываемых на транзакцию
Кому важен Разработчикам и пользователям смарт‑контрактов Всем, кто отправляет простые транзакции

Пошагово: как получить энергию в кошельке

Если коротко, процесс прост и понятен. Но здесь важно понимать нюансы, чтобы не потратить лишнего. Ниже — пошаговая инструкция для тех, кто делает это впервые.

  • Откройте свой TRON‑кошелёк и выберите опцию «Freeze». Обычно она находится в разделе управления балансом или ресурсов.
  • Выберите сумму TRX, которую хотите заморозить, и укажите ресурс — энергия или полосу пропускания. Некоторые кошельки позволяют заморозить под оба ресурса одновременно.
  • Подтвердите операцию. После заморозки вы получите ресурсы в своём аккаунте, и они будут списываться при совершении транзакций.
  • Если энергия нужна единовременно, используйте функцию покупки ресурсов: система рассчитает стоимость и снимет соответствующее количество TRX.

Важно: заморозка блокирует средства на определённый период, после которого вы сможете их разморозить. Если вы не уверены в сумме, лучше начинать с небольших сумм и анализировать потребности в дальнейших операциях.

Делегирование и спонсорство транзакций

Для DApp разработчиков есть удобный прием: можно замораживать TRX на адресе приложения и делегировать ресурсы пользователям, либо реализовать модель спонсирования транзакций, когда DApp оплачивает энергию за действия пользователей. Это улучшает опыт, особенно для новых пользователей, которым не хочется разбираться с заморозкой и ресурсами.

Реализация требует аккуратно продуманной логики безопасности: вы не должны бесконтрольно расходовать ресурсы, поэтому важно ограничивать квоты и следить за поведением пользователей, чтобы предотвратить злоупотребления.

Оптимизация расхода энергии в смарт‑контрактах

Самый заметный и полезный навык для разработчика — экономить энергию на уровне кода. Маленькие изменения в логике могут значительно снизить расход ресурсов и, как следствие, стоимость работы DApp. Вот самые практичные приёмы, которые действительно работают.

  1. Минимизируйте операции записи в хранилище. Запись стоит дороже, чем чтение, и если есть возможность хранить данные вне блокчейна или агрегировать записи — делайте это.
  2. Избегайте ненужных циклов и сложных вычислений внутри транзакций. Часто можно перенести часть логики на фронтенд или сделать её офф‑чейн.
  3. Используйте view и pure функции для чтения данных. Такие вызовы, если выполняются локально, не тратят энергию.
  4. Планируйте взаимодействие между контрактами. Количество внешних вызовов влияет на общий расход энергии.
Читайте также:  Как сделать подвесное кресло кокон своими руками

Каждое из этих правил снижает не только энергетические расходы, но и общую задержку транзакций. А ещё делает код чище и понятнее, что в долгой перспективе экономнее.

Практические примеры и сценарии

Представьте простой DApp: пользователи отправляют токены и обновляют профиль. Переводы можно сделать дешевыми, используя базовую полосу пропускания. Обновление профиля, которое пишет много данных, потребует энергии. В этом случае разумно разделить операции: перевод — отдельная низкозатратная транзакция, профиль — оптимизированный контракт, где хранятся только критичные данные, а остальное — в офф‑чейн хранилище.

Другой сценарий: NFT‑маркетплейс. Минтинг NFT обычно дорогой по энергии, поэтому для массового выпуска имеет смысл замораживать TRX заранее или внедрить покупку энергии непосредственно при минте, чтобы пользователь видел прозрачную цену и мог принять решение.

Безопасность и мониторинг ресурсов

Контроль за расходом ресурсов — часть безопасности. Необходимо мониторить потребление энергии, чтобы вовремя заметить аномалии, например резкий рост расходов, который может свидетельствовать о баге или атаке. На уровне проекта стоит настроить алерты и квоты, а также периодические отчёты по потреблению.

Ещё один момент — права доступа. Если DApp делегирует ресурсы пользователям, убедитесь, что механизм делегирования не позволяет злоумышленнику присвоить себе ресурсы или повторно их использовать. Простейшая практика — вести лимиты по аккаунтам и логи операций.

Какова экономическая логика для пользователя и разработчика

Пользователю важно одно: чтобы операции были дешевыми и предсказуемыми. Для разработчика же — добиться баланса между затратами и удобством. Иногда выгоднее платить за ресурсы централизованно и таким образом улучшить UX, иногда — заставить активных пользователей замораживать свои TRX и получать ресурсы как бонусы за активность.

Стоит также учитывать волатильность цены TRX и загруженность сети. В периоды пиковых нагрузок покупка энергии может стать дороже, и заморозка окажется более выгодной стратегией. Анализируйте данные и стройте экономику проекта с учётом реальных сценариев использования.

Заключение

Энергия в TRON — это понятный и управляемый ресурс. Она позволяет сети распределять нагрузку и снижать стоимость простых транзакций, одновременно давая разработчикам инструменты для гибкой монетизации и обеспечения удобства пользователя. Заморозка TRX выгодна тем, кто часто взаимодействует с контрактами, покупка энергии — для разовых задач. А грамотная оптимизация смарт‑контрактов может значительно сократить ваши расходы. Если подходить к вопросу осознанно, ресурсы TRON станут не источником головной боли, а инструментом, который делает приложения быстрее, дешевле и удобнее.

Опубликовано: 19 января 2026
(Пока оценок нет)
Загрузка...

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*